Another fantastic and huge climb to an alpine dam / lake.

The route starts in Visp in the main valley. The first nine kilometres is the same road that leads to Zermatt and the Matterhorn, so there is some traffic. But once the route turns towards Saas Fee things get quieter.

It’s not the hardest climb but 1580 metres of ascent is, for example, more than any climb in this year’s Tour.

The best part of the climb is the last few kilometres as things get steep as the dam comes into sight. There is a glacier above the finish at the end of a very straight steep last half kilometre:

You can walk on the dam. And while the paved road ends here, with a mountain bike it looks possible to ride around the large lake (a future project)?
